On 7 March, Ukrainians received assistance from UNICEF in the form of 62 tons of commodities. 6 truckloads of emergency supplies were delivered during martial law. First of all, medical kits, medicines, and children’s toys have arrived in the country. Hospitals and maternity hospitals are now equipped with all the necessary equipment for continuous operation.
